共用方式為


InternalNetworks interface

代表 InternalNetworks 的介面。

方法

beginCreate(string, string, string, InternalNetwork, InternalNetworksCreateOptionalParams)

建立 InternalNetwork PUT 方法。

beginCreateAndWait(string, string, string, InternalNetwork, InternalNetworksCreateOptionalParams)

建立 InternalNetwork PUT 方法。

beginDelete(string, string, string, InternalNetworksDeleteOptionalParams)

實作 InternalNetworks DELETE 方法。

beginDeleteAndWait(string, string, string, InternalNetworksDeleteOptionalParams)

實作 InternalNetworks DELETE 方法。

beginUpdate(string, string, string, InternalNetworkPatch, InternalNetworksUpdateOptionalParams)

更新 InternalNetworks。

beginUpdateAdministrativeState(string, string, string, UpdateAdministrativeState, InternalNetworksUpdateAdministrativeStateOptionalParams)

更新其資源識別碼所參考資源的 InternalNetworks 系統管理狀態。

beginUpdateAdministrativeStateAndWait(string, string, string, UpdateAdministrativeState, InternalNetworksUpdateAdministrativeStateOptionalParams)

更新其資源識別碼所參考資源的 InternalNetworks 系統管理狀態。

beginUpdateAndWait(string, string, string, InternalNetworkPatch, InternalNetworksUpdateOptionalParams)

更新 InternalNetworks。

beginUpdateBgpAdministrativeState(string, string, string, UpdateAdministrativeState, InternalNetworksUpdateBgpAdministrativeStateOptionalParams)

更新 internalNetwork 的 BGP 狀態。 僅允許在邊緣裝置上使用。

beginUpdateBgpAdministrativeStateAndWait(string, string, string, UpdateAdministrativeState, InternalNetworksUpdateBgpAdministrativeStateOptionalParams)

更新 internalNetwork 的 BGP 狀態。 僅允許在邊緣裝置上使用。

beginUpdateStaticRouteBfdAdministrativeState(string, string, string, UpdateAdministrativeState, InternalNetworksUpdateStaticRouteBfdAdministrativeStateOptionalParams)

更新 internalNetwork 的靜態路由 BFD 系統管理狀態。

beginUpdateStaticRouteBfdAdministrativeStateAndWait(string, string, string, UpdateAdministrativeState, InternalNetworksUpdateStaticRouteBfdAdministrativeStateOptionalParams)

更新 internalNetwork 的靜態路由 BFD 系統管理狀態。

get(string, string, string, InternalNetworksGetOptionalParams)

取得 InternalNetworks。

listByL3IsolationDomain(string, string, InternalNetworksListByL3IsolationDomainOptionalParams)

依資源群組 GET 方法顯示 InternalNetworks 清單。

方法詳細資料

beginCreate(string, string, string, InternalNetwork, InternalNetworksCreateOptionalParams)

建立 InternalNetwork PUT 方法。

function beginCreate(resourceGroupName: string, l3IsolationDomainName: string, internalNetworkName: string, body: InternalNetwork, options?: InternalNetworksCreateOptionalParams): Promise<SimplePollerLike<OperationState<InternalNetwork>, InternalNetwork>>

參數

resourceGroupName

string

資源群組的名稱。 名稱不區分大小寫。

l3IsolationDomainName

string

L3 隔離網域的名稱。

internalNetworkName

string

內部網路的名稱。

body
InternalNetwork

要求承載。

options
InternalNetworksCreateOptionalParams

選項參數。

傳回

Promise<@azure/core-lro.SimplePollerLike<OperationState<InternalNetwork>, InternalNetwork>>

beginCreateAndWait(string, string, string, InternalNetwork, InternalNetworksCreateOptionalParams)

建立 InternalNetwork PUT 方法。

function beginCreateAndWait(resourceGroupName: string, l3IsolationDomainName: string, internalNetworkName: string, body: InternalNetwork, options?: InternalNetworksCreateOptionalParams): Promise<InternalNetwork>

參數

resourceGroupName

string

資源群組的名稱。 名稱不區分大小寫。

l3IsolationDomainName

string

L3 隔離網域的名稱。

internalNetworkName

string

內部網路的名稱。

body
InternalNetwork

要求承載。

options
InternalNetworksCreateOptionalParams

選項參數。

傳回

Promise<InternalNetwork>

beginDelete(string, string, string, InternalNetworksDeleteOptionalParams)

實作 InternalNetworks DELETE 方法。

function beginDelete(resourceGroupName: string, l3IsolationDomainName: string, internalNetworkName: string, options?: InternalNetworksDeleteO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>

參數

resourceGroupName

string

資源群組的名稱。 名稱不區分大小寫。

l3IsolationDomainName

string

L3 隔離網域的名稱。

internalNetworkName

string

內部網路的名稱。

options
InternalNetworksDeleteOptionalParams

選項參數。

傳回

Promise<@azure/core-lro.SimplePollerLike<OperationState<void>, void>>

beginDeleteAndWait(string, string, string, InternalNetworksDeleteOptionalParams)

實作 InternalNetworks DELETE 方法。

function beginDeleteAndWait(resourceGroupName: string, l3IsolationDomainName: string, internalNetworkName: string, options?: InternalNetworksDeleteOptionalParams): Promise<void>

參數

resourceGroupName

string

資源群組的名稱。 名稱不區分大小寫。

l3IsolationDomainName

string

L3 隔離網域的名稱。

internalNetworkName

string

內部網路的名稱。

options
InternalNetworksDeleteOptionalParams

選項參數。

傳回

Promise<void>

beginUpdate(string, string, string, InternalNetworkPatch, InternalNetworksUpdateOptionalParams)

更新 InternalNetworks。

function beginUpdate(resourceGroupName: string, l3IsolationDomainName: string, internalNetworkName: string, body: InternalNetworkPatch, options?: InternalNetworksUpdateOptionalParams): Promise<SimplePollerLike<OperationState<InternalNetwork>, InternalNetwork>>

參數

resourceGroupName

string

資源群組的名稱。 名稱不區分大小寫。

l3IsolationDomainName

string

L3 隔離網域的名稱。

internalNetworkName

string

內部網路的名稱。

body
InternalNetworkPatch

要更新的 InternalNetwork 屬性。 僅支援批註。

options
InternalNetworksUpdateOptionalParams

選項參數。

傳回

Promise<@azure/core-lro.SimplePollerLike<OperationState<InternalNetwork>, InternalNetwork>>

beginUpdateAdministrativeState(string, string, string, UpdateAdministrativeState, InternalNetworksUpdateAdministrativeStateOptionalParams)

更新其資源識別碼所參考資源的 InternalNetworks 系統管理狀態。

function beginUpdateAdministrativeState(resourceGroupName: string, l3IsolationDomainName: string, internalNetworkName: string, body: UpdateAdministrativeState, options?: InternalNetworksUpdateAdministrativeStateOptionalParams): Promise<SimplePollerLike<OperationState<CommonPostActionResponseForStateUpdate>, CommonPostActionResponseForStateUpdate>>

參數

resourceGroupName

string

資源群組的名稱。 名稱不區分大小寫。

l3IsolationDomainName

string

L3 隔離網域的名稱。

internalNetworkName

string

內部網路的名稱。

body
UpdateAdministrativeState

要求承載。

傳回

beginUpdateAdministrativeStateAndWait(string, string, string, UpdateAdministrativeState, InternalNetworksUpdateAdministrativeStateOptionalParams)

更新其資源識別碼所參考資源的 InternalNetworks 系統管理狀態。

function beginUpdateAdministrativeStateAndWait(resourceGroupName: string, l3IsolationDomainName: string, internalNetworkName: string, body: UpdateAdministrativeState, options?: InternalNetworksUpdateAdministrativeStateOptionalParams): Promise<CommonPostActionResponseForStateUpdate>

參數

resourceGroupName

string

資源群組的名稱。 名稱不區分大小寫。

l3IsolationDomainName

string

L3 隔離網域的名稱。

internalNetworkName

string

內部網路的名稱。

body
UpdateAdministrativeState

要求承載。

傳回

beginUpdateAndWait(string, string, string, InternalNetworkPatch, InternalNetworksUpdateOptionalParams)

更新 InternalNetworks。

function beginUpdateAndWait(resourceGroupName: string, l3IsolationDomainName: string, internalNetworkName: string, body: InternalNetworkPatch, options?: InternalNetworksUpdateOptionalParams): Promise<InternalNetwork>

參數

resourceGroupName

string

資源群組的名稱。 名稱不區分大小寫。

l3IsolationDomainName

string

L3 隔離網域的名稱。

internalNetworkName

string

內部網路的名稱。

body
InternalNetworkPatch

要更新的 InternalNetwork 屬性。 僅支援批註。

options
InternalNetworksUpdateOptionalParams

選項參數。

傳回

Promise<InternalNetwork>

beginUpdateBgpAdministrativeState(string, string, string, UpdateAdministrativeState, InternalNetworksUpdateBgpAdministrativeStateOptionalParams)

更新 internalNetwork 的 BGP 狀態。 僅允許在邊緣裝置上使用。

function beginUpdateBgpAdministrativeState(resourceGroupName: string, l3IsolationDomainName: string, internalNetworkName: string, body: UpdateAdministrativeState, options?: InternalNetworksUpdateBgpAdministrativeStateOptionalParams): Promise<SimplePollerLike<OperationState<CommonPostActionResponseForStateUpdate>, CommonPostActionResponseForStateUpdate>>

參數

resourceGroupName

string

資源群組的名稱。 名稱不區分大小寫。

l3IsolationDomainName

string

L3 隔離網域的名稱。

internalNetworkName

string

內部網路的名稱。

body
UpdateAdministrativeState

要求承載。

傳回

beginUpdateBgpAdministrativeStateAndWait(string, string, string, UpdateAdministrativeState, InternalNetworksUpdateBgpAdministrativeStateOptionalParams)

更新 internalNetwork 的 BGP 狀態。 僅允許在邊緣裝置上使用。

function beginUpdateBgpAdministrativeStateAndWait(resourceGroupName: string, l3IsolationDomainName: string, internalNetworkName: string, body: UpdateAdministrativeState, options?: InternalNetworksUpdateBgpAdministrativeStateOptionalParams): Promise<CommonPostActionResponseForStateUpdate>

參數

resourceGroupName

string

資源群組的名稱。 名稱不區分大小寫。

l3IsolationDomainName

string

L3 隔離網域的名稱。

internalNetworkName

string

內部網路的名稱。

body
UpdateAdministrativeState

要求承載。

傳回

beginUpdateStaticRouteBfdAdministrativeState(string, string, string, UpdateAdministrativeState, InternalNetworksUpdateStaticRouteBfdAdministrativeStateOptionalParams)

更新 internalNetwork 的靜態路由 BFD 系統管理狀態。

function beginUpdateStaticRouteBfdAdministrativeState(resourceGroupName: string, l3IsolationDomainName: string, internalNetworkName: string, body: UpdateAdministrativeState, options?: InternalNetworksUpdateStaticRouteBfdAdministrativeStateOptionalParams): Promise<SimplePollerLike<OperationState<CommonPostActionResponseForStateUpdate>, CommonPostActionResponseForStateUpdate>>

參數

resourceGroupName

string

資源群組的名稱。 名稱不區分大小寫。

l3IsolationDomainName

string

L3 隔離網域的名稱。

internalNetworkName

string

內部網路的名稱。

body
UpdateAdministrativeState

要求承載。

傳回

beginUpdateStaticRouteBfdAdministrativeStateAndWait(string, string, string, UpdateAdministrativeState, InternalNetworksUpdateStaticRouteBfdAdministrativeStateOptionalParams)

更新 internalNetwork 的靜態路由 BFD 系統管理狀態。

function beginUpdateStaticRouteBfdAdministrativeStateAndWait(resourceGroupName: string, l3IsolationDomainName: string, internalNetworkName: string, body: UpdateAdministrativeState, options?: InternalNetworksUpdateStaticRouteBfdAdministrativeStateOptionalParams): Promise<CommonPostActionResponseForStateUpdate>

參數

resourceGroupName

string

資源群組的名稱。 名稱不區分大小寫。

l3IsolationDomainName

string

L3 隔離網域的名稱。

internalNetworkName

string

內部網路的名稱。

body
UpdateAdministrativeState

要求承載。

傳回

get(string, string, string, InternalNetworksGetOptionalParams)

取得 InternalNetworks。

function get(resourceGroupName: string, l3IsolationDomainName: string, internalNetworkName: string, options?: InternalNetworksGetOptionalParams): Promise<InternalNetwork>

參數

resourceGroupName

string

資源群組的名稱。 名稱不區分大小寫。

l3IsolationDomainName

string

L3 隔離網域的名稱。

internalNetworkName

string

內部網路的名稱。

options
InternalNetworksGetOptionalParams

選項參數。

傳回

Promise<InternalNetwork>

listByL3IsolationDomain(string, string, InternalNetworksListByL3IsolationDomainOptionalParams)

依資源群組 GET 方法顯示 InternalNetworks 清單。

function listByL3IsolationDomain(resourceGroupName: string, l3IsolationDomainName: string, options?: InternalNetworksListByL3IsolationDomainOptionalParams): PagedAsyncIterableIterator<InternalNetwork, InternalNetwork[], PageSettings>

參數

resourceGroupName

string

資源群組的名稱。 名稱不區分大小寫。

l3IsolationDomainName

string

L3 隔離網域的名稱。

傳回